Coefficient Inverse Problem for an Equation of Mixed Parabolic-Hyperbolic Type with Nonlocal Conditions

Annotatsiya

The direct and inverse problems for a model mixed parabolic-hyperoblic equation with a characteristic line of type change have been studied. In the direct problem, a nonlocal problem for this equation with interior boundary conditions in the hyperbolic part of the domain has been investigated. The unknown of the inverse problem is the variable coefficient of the lower-order term in the parabolic equation. To determine it, the inverse problem is studied under the assumption that an integral overdetermination condition is known for the solution defined in the parabolic part of the domain. A theorem of unique solvability for the posed problems in the sense of a classical solution has been proven.
